MEMO — Branch Managers

Effective next quarter, marketing spend is reduced 18% across all Verlane Foods branches. No exceptions. Local campaigns above 5,000 credits require sign-off from Regional Director Hask. Reallocate remaining funds to the Copperline loyalty push only. Questions go through your regional lead. The rationale is outlined in the note below.

management briefing: Project Ulavan slips by two quarters because of the staffing delay.

Quarterly Planning Note — Helix Migration Delay
To: Heads of Department

The Helix data-migration project at Brantwood Systems will slip one quarter due to staffing gaps and unresolved schema issues. Revised milestones follow next week; dependent teams should adjust their roadmaps now. Please treat the following planning detail as strictly confidential.

board note of bawep-tajef: Queniusek Systems plans to raise the Quenvan list price by 53.1 percent in March. The pricing group signed off on a budget of $176.4 million for Project Drueth. The renewal with Casionix Partners closes at $142.5 million a year, 8.3 percent below the last contract. Project Fraax slips by six weeks because of the tooling delay.

Subject: DR drill prep — Chalkline timetable solver

Hello,

As our new contractor, please read this before Friday's disaster-recovery drill. We will simulate a full outage of the Chalkline school timetable solver and restore it on the Fernbrook standby environment. Your task is to bring the solver's scheduling service back online and verify three sample timetables. The restore tool will prompt you to re-authenticate, and it accepts only the recovery passphrase given below.

unlock words, yawig-kagef: gordor-holvan-ulaael-pramir-ulaiel-tamdor

- [ ] Step 7: Archive cold storage buckets (Glacierline tier). Confirm both ceremony witnesses are present, verify bucket manifests match the Oxbow ledger, then seal the archive key shares. Plugin authors may observe but not handle shares. Once sealed, the archive index itself is encrypted and can only be reopened with the passphrase below.

vault phrase of badup-hahig = tamael-aldael-kelmir-istael-fenok-istwyn-tamius-jorath-oliion